What Happens If I Don't Claim a Macy's Gift Card?

You are the recipient of a Macy's gift card from a friend, coworker or family member, but you never claim the card. What happens to the card or the funds used to purchase it? About Macy's Gift Cards

You can purchase a gift card for a friend or family member and have it sent electronically as an e-card or via regular mail as a plastic gift card. Gift cards don't expire, so once purchased, the funds sit on the gift card until they are used.

When the Gift Card Is Unclaimed

Unfortunately, Macy's gift cards cannot be exchanged for cash at any Macy's location or through the online customer portal; however, you do have options.

  1. If you are the recipient of the gift and received an email notifying you of an e-gift card, you simply need to locate the email and accept the card. Once you have the card, you can use it at any time.
  2. If you are the one sending the e-gift or classic card that was never used or claimed, you can call Macy's customer support to request a replacement for a lost or stolen card. You must provide proof of purchase to get a replacement card for the value left on the original gift card.
  3. As the sender, check with the intended recipient before contacting customer support. The person receiving the gift may have forgotten it, or they may be saving it to use toward a larger purchase or special occasion.

Unfortunately, there is little you can do when a gift card isn't claimed other than reach out to the recipient if it was a gift to remind them to use it or use the card yourself for your own purchase. If the card isn't claimed because it was lost or stolen, you can contact Macy's customer support and request a replacement card.
